Akagera National Park – The Best Place for Game Drives in Rwanda
Akagera National Park is Rwanda’s only savannah wildlife destination and home to the legendary Big Five—lions, leopards, elephants, rhinos, and buffaloes. The park also hosts giraffes, hippos, crocodiles, zebras, hyenas, oribis, impalas, bushbucks, elands, warthogs, baboons, vervet monkeys, and more than 500 bird species. Because Akagera is less crowded than many larger East African parks, visitors enjoy closer wildlife encounters, peaceful photo opportunities, and pristine natural surroundings.

Beautiful Landscapes and Unique Safari Experience
One of the reasons game drives in Akagera are special is the dramatic scenery. The park features open plains, riverine woodlands, papyrus swamps, and a chain of picturesque lakes. While driving through the park, guests enjoy breathtaking views of grasslands, rolling hills, and long winding tracks that create a true feeling of wilderness. Because Akagera is well-protected and carefully managed, wildlife has flourished here in recent years. It is now one of the most successful conservation areas in Africa, with growing populations of lions, black rhinos, and white rhinos.

Boat Safari on Lake Ihema – A Perfect Addition to Game Drives
A highlight of Akagera safaris is the boat safari on Lake Ihema, one of the most scenic lakes in the park. During the boat cruise, guests enjoy close-range views of hippos, giant Nile crocodiles, elephants drinking by the water, buffaloes cooling off, and hundreds of water birds. Kingfishers, fish eagles, herons, and African jacanas are often seen along the shore. The boat safari adds a relaxing and photographic experience that complements land-based game drives perfectly. Best Time for Game Drives in Rwanda
Game drives in Rwanda are available all year. The dry seasons of June to September and December to February offer the best wildlife viewing, as animals gather near water sources and visibility is clearer. However, even during the rainy months, Akagera remains beautiful and full of life.
